The Diamond S Earth Shattering Bucking Genetics Sale was just that earth shattering. Billy and Kay Jaynes did a great job managing and marketing the sale and Diamond S and Blessed Buckers showed that the proof was in their breeding programs and the buyers knew it. Superior the phones rang so much that it was hard to keep up with them.
Joe Don Pogue did a great job behind the microphone with Clint Menchu and James Grant handling the responsibilities in the ring. Great numbers, smooth sale. I don’t know who numbered the lots but that’s how it came out, something to ask Billy Jaynes.
